From: Ross Zwisler Date: Sat, 16 Jan 2016 00:56:02 +0000 (-0800) Subject: mm, dax: fix livelock, allow dax pmd mappings to become writeable X-Git-Tag: v4.5-rc1~77^2~66 X-Git-Url: https://git.karo-electronics.de/?a=commitdiff_plain;h=01871e59af5cc1cbf290ad6b4b95cd2f0cec9e8c;p=karo-tx-linux.git mm, dax: fix livelock, allow dax pmd mappings to become writeable Prior to this change DAX PMD mappings that were made read-only were never able to be made writable again. This is because the code in insert_pfn_pmd() that calls pmd_mkdirty() and pmd_mkwrite() would skip these calls if the PMD already existed in the page table. Instead, if we are doing a write always mark the PMD entry as dirty and writeable. Without this code we can get into a condition where we mark the PMD as read-only, and then on a subsequent write fault we get into an infinite loop of PMD faults where we try unsuccessfully to make the PMD writeable.
